Spring Batch 批处理框架:实力非凡

2024-12-31 01:23:12   小编

Spring Batch 批处理框架:实力非凡

在当今数字化时代,数据处理的高效性和准确性至关重要。Spring Batch 批处理框架应运而生,以其卓越的性能和强大的功能,成为众多企业解决大规模数据处理问题的首选。

Spring Batch 框架提供了一套完整而成熟的批处理解决方案。它能够处理海量的数据,无论是文件数据、数据库中的数据,还是来自外部系统的数据。其强大的任务调度和管理功能,使得复杂的批处理流程可以被清晰地定义和组织。通过合理的配置和规划,用户可以轻松地设置任务的执行顺序、依赖关系以及并发度,从而最大程度地提高处理效率。

该框架具有高度的可扩展性。它允许开发人员根据具体的业务需求,自定义数据读取器、处理器和写入器。这意味着无论是处理特殊格式的数据文件,还是执行复杂的数据转换逻辑,Spring Batch 都能够提供灵活的支持。

在错误处理方面,Spring Batch 表现出色。它能够自动捕获和处理在批处理过程中出现的各种错误,并且可以根据预设的策略进行重试或记录错误信息。这极大地提高了批处理作业的稳定性和可靠性,确保数据处理的完整性和准确性。

另外,Spring Batch 还提供了丰富的监控和跟踪机制。用户可以实时了解批处理任务的执行进度、处理的数据量以及各种性能指标。这有助于及时发现潜在的问题,并对批处理流程进行优化和调整。

与其他技术框架的集成也非常便捷。无论是与 Spring 框架的其他组件,还是与常见的数据库、消息队列等技术,Spring Batch 都能够无缝对接,充分发挥整个技术栈的优势。

Spring Batch 批处理框架以其强大的功能、高度的可扩展性、出色的错误处理和便捷的监控机制,展现出了非凡的实力。在面对日益增长的数据处理需求时,它无疑是企业实现高效、准确和可靠数据处理的得力助手。无论是大型企业的复杂业务场景,还是中小型企业的特定数据处理任务,Spring Batch 都能为其提供优质的服务,助力企业在数字化竞争中脱颖而出。

TAGS: Spring Batch 框架优势 Spring Batch 应用场景 Spring Batch 技术特点 Spring Batch 实力展现

欢迎使用万千站长工具!

Welcome to www.zzTool.com